TN TRB

The TN TRB Polytechnic Exam, also known as the Tamil Nadu Teachers Recruitment Board (TN TRB) Polytechnic Lecturers Exam, is a competitive examination conducted by the Tamil Nadu Teachers Recruitment Board (TN TRB) through online applications applied by eligible candidates for the Direct Recruitment of Lecturers in Govt. Polytechnic Colleges and other special institutions in the state of Tamil Nadu, India.

SELECTION PROCEDURE & EXAM PATTERN

The selection will be based on two successive stages viz.

a. Computer-based examination (190 Marks)
b. Awarding Weightage marks during Certificate Verification (10 Marks based on Educational Qualification like Master’s Degree / PhD and Teaching Experience)

TN-TRB Computer Based Test (CBT) Exam Pattern
Sl. No Subject Questions Marks
1 Main Paper (Engineering or Non-Engineering) Selected by the Candidates 1 Mark (100) 100
Main Paper (Engineering or Non-Engineering) Selected by the Candidates 2 Marks (40) 80
2 General Knowledge 1 Mark (10) 10
Total Marks for 150 Questions 190
  • The Educational Qualification and Age Limit are given below.

    • For Engineering Aspirants: A Bachelor’s Degree in the appropriate branch of Engineering / Technology / Architecture with not less than sixty percent of marks or equivalent.

    • For Non-Engineering Aspirants: First Class Master’s degree in the appropriate branch of study.

    There is NO AGE LIMIT for this exam. Candidates should not have completed 57 years as on the notification date as per G.O. (Ms) No.156 Higher Education (B1) Department Dated: 15/09/2014.

Civil
  • Engineering Mathematics: Linear algebra, Calculus, Differential equations, Complex variables, Probability and statistics, Numerical methods.

  • Core Civil Engineering: Mechanics, Structural analysis, Concrete structures, Steel structures, Soil mechanics, Foundation engineering, Fluid mechanics, machines, and hydrology, Water supply and waste disposal, Highway engineering.

Mechanical
  • Engineering Mathematics: Linear algebra, Calculus, Differential equations, Complex variables, Probability and statistics, Numerical methods.

  • Core Mechanical: Applied mechanics and strength of materials, Theory of machines and design, Theory of machines, Design of machine elements, Fluid mechanics and hydraulic machinery, Heat transfer, Thermodynamics, Manufacturing Engineering, Engineering materials, Metal casting, Forming joining Processes, Machining and machine tool operations, Metrology and inspection, Computer integrated manufacturing, Production planning and control, Operations research.

Electrical
  • Engineering Mathematics: Linear algebra, Calculus, Differential equations, Complex variables, Probability and statistics, Numerical methods.

  • Core Electrical & Electronics: Electric circuits and fields, Digital signal processing, Electrical machines, Power systems, Protection and switchgear, Control system, Electrical and electronics measurements, Analog and digital electronics, Power electronics and drives.

ECE
  • Engineering Mathematics: Linear algebra, Calculus, Differential equations, Complex variables, Probability and statistics, Numerical methods.

  • Core ECE: Networks, Electromagnetics, Electronic devices and circuits, Digital circuits, CMOS VLSI systems, Signal processing, Control systems, Analog and digital communication systems, Computer communication.
